Allowing FPA and Prescriptive Authority (PA) enables NPs to become more efficient and effective patient care team members. However, physician resistance to FPA and PA presents barriers to implementation. WebTwo years after the Florida legislature expanded APRN prescribing to include schedule II-IV drugs in 2024, we studied APRN utilization of this prescriptive authority. Study results reveal that Florida APRNs are meeting the educational requirements to prescribe and apply the use of these drugs in practice, improving patient access to care. how to yarn over before a purl stitch https://wearevini.com
